Incyte's VGA039 Shows Bleed Reduction in All Von Willebrand Types at ISTH 2026
Read source articleWhat happened
Incyte presented Phase 1/2 multidose data for VGA039 (Latarcibart) at ISTH 2026, showing substantial bleed reductions in patients with all von Willebrand disease types. The data supports the potential of this novel factor VIII replacement therapy as a new treatment option for VWD, a condition with limited approved therapies. While encouraging, the data is early-stage and from a small number of patients; larger pivotal trials are needed to confirm efficacy and safety. For Incyte, this adds to the pipeline of non-Jakafi assets, but does not change the near-term revenue dependence on Jakafi and Opzelura. The stock already reflects a diversified growth narrative, and this news is unlikely to materially move the needle given the long timeline to potential approval.
